Now they make up an entire film and each VOB works but I dont have the core files like the Video_ts files etc. My question is can I import those .vob files above into a DVD authoring program and created a full DVD video structure again?
I haven't done this but you might want to use a program like Voblanker or FixVTS and maybe those programs can fix your DVD structure and make a Video_ts and BUP files! But I can't be sure.
Thanks for all the help and info guys, I may have gone the long way around but this is how I got it working:
there was a fault in the first .vob file causing it to fail when importing it into DVDlab, so I used FixVTS to repair that VOB and then I could import it into DVDlab, and demultiplex them all, and finally recreating a DVD structure.
